Step 2: Upgrade to Proselint-Q 4. The old rule IDs are gone; plugins referencing them will fail registration. Rename rules per the mapping table in Step 1 before proceeding. Severity overrides now live in the linter config, not the plugin manifest — remove any severity keys from your manifest or the loader rejects it. Autofix hooks must declare idempotency. Run the dry-run mode once before enabling enforcement. The linter ships with the following default configuration.

config for kagup-hahig:
druwyn:
  pin: 2801
  metrics_host: metrics.druwyn.zemvarlabs.internal
  tenant: sorius
  seal: seal_798a43d7

Subject: Heads-up on a possible acquisition

Hi all — quick note for branch managers: we're in early talks to acquire Fennick Tools, a small outfitter operating across the Morrow Valley. Nothing is signed, so please keep branch operations as usual and route any questions to Priya. If it proceeds, integration would start next spring. There's one confidential detail I need to share below.

board note of tawig-bajof: The renewal with Ralixix Holdings closes at $10 million a year, 20 percent above the last contract. Project Druix slips by two quarters because of the tooling delay.

# Break-Glass: Export Worker Memory Limits

The Ledgerfen spreadsheet export workers occasionally exceed their 4 GB ceiling on tenants with very wide sheets, triggering repeated OOM kills. If exports are failing platform-wide and the queue is backing up, break-glass access lets on-call raise the memory cap temporarily. Log the incident number first, then open the emergency config console. Authenticate with the recovery passphrase recorded below.

unlock words, tawif-tahop: oliys-ulawyn-tamdor-lamys-casox-jormir-fraius-kasath-ulador-ulamir-holir-sorys-holeth

Minutes – Management Meeting, Harwick Trading Co.

Quick recap for branch managers: we agreed to write down the unsold Lumacrest patio stock sitting in the Dellfield warehouse since spring. Marta walked us through the numbers — roughly a third of the line won't move at full price, so finance will book the write-down this quarter rather than drag it into next year. Branches should pull remaining Lumacrest units from floor displays by month-end. Before you circulate this, note the confidential item below.

internal memo for faweg-tafog: Only 7 of the 100 pilot accounts renewed Quenael, so a churn review is set for April 15.